SPECIAL WAYS TO PAY TRIBUTE TO YOUR LOST PET

Image
Sending tribute to your lost pet has the capacity to give you calmness and help you move out of grief for the loss of your pet. It is therefore important to understand the special ways through which you can pay tribute to your lost pet. Tribute cannot only be sent through the reading of the eulogy, there are countless methods through which you can pay tribute to your lost pet. 1. Making a photo album Photos and every trace of memories shared with your pet that was captured through an image are very helpful in accepting the reality that the pet has been lost. You can choose to stack these photos in an album both the photos taken during the time of life of the pet and on the aftercare services. These are the images that will keep memories of the pet forever. You can be tempted to consider a photo album as an old-style and outdated over the current tech methods of storing photos. What Does Cremating Your Pet Involve

Image
Pets are considered a part of the family in most households. Their unconditional love for the entire family is the reason why they’re everyone’s favourite family member. Whether you have a dog, a cat or any other animal as your pet, their death can have a lasting impact on your life. Upon experiencing the passing of a beloved pet, there are various ways in which you can deal with their bodies. You can either have them buried in a pet cemetery or have them cremated. In most places, cremation is the most popular method of disposing of dead pets. To understand this process, read on to learn the steps involved. Selection of the Crematorium A crematorium is a place where bodily remains of humans and animals are cremated. Some crematoriums exclusively provide cremation services specifically for pets.
